How Does Windows Defender Work on Mac?
For those unfamiliar with the basics of Windows Defender, it's essential to understand how it works. Windows Defender, now integrated into Windows 10, provides real-time protection against malware and other online threats. On a Mac, Windows Defender can be used in a virtualized environment, such as Boot Camp or a compatible third-party software. However, this approach is not without its limitations. When attempting to scan an external hard drive using Windows Defender on a Mac, the operating system may not recognize the drive, or the scan might not be comprehensive due to compatibility issues.
